  • This popular beach is located at the opposite end of a long sandy stretch to Fraserburgh town.

    The Waters of Philorth is named after the nature reserve that runs along the back of the beach. This is a rare estuarine environment which attracts a variety of waders, wildfowl and seabirds. There is also an extensive dune system that extends across Fraserburgh Bay.
